The political unrest in the Balkans is still not history. The Serb Ljubisa Tumbakovic has refused to serve the Montenegrins in the international match against Kosovo, and was thus released. Since mid-July, Bosnian Faruk Hadzibegic has been the new coach in Montenegro, and he should at least try to lead his team close to the first two places in this group.
If it had not been the political aspects of separation from the coach, then the dismissal would have been quite justified from a sporting point of view. Before Faruk Hadzibegic took the helm, there was no victory in six games. Under these circumstances, a team has lost nothing in a EURO anyway.

After all, there was a 2-1 victory against Faruk Hadzibegic’s debut last Thursday in a friendly against Hungary. However, the Magyars, who were also far from their home team, took the lead 2-0 after just two minutes. Nebojsa Kosovic and Stefan Mugosa by penalty were able to turn the tables in a 2-1 victory.
On Tuesday, the new coach will again be able to fall back on his current only star in the team. Stefan Savic, who has traveled to the national team despite the refusal of his club Atletico Madrid, is likely to play against the Czech Republic.
Another leader is still unavailable. Stevan Jovetic from AS Monaco is injured and thus lacks a lot of offensive power. Overall, we expect a similar lineup as in the friendly against the Hungarians. Of course, should Stefan Savic, who was spared on Thursday, move into the team.

However, the Czech Republic lost in three out of the last four away games. Home and away games seem to be two different pairs of shoes for the Czechs. In Montenegro, the away weakness must be filed, otherwise threatens the team of Jaroslav Silhavy this summer only the spectator role.
They had the Czech players in Kosovo in the crucial scenes also held. The new Leipzig Patrik Schick brought his team after a quarter of an hour with 1: 0 lead. Kosovo could use its own chances, in contrast to the other possibilities of the Czechs, and won in the end 2-1.
